Latest Sustainability Reporting

Highlights


  • Achieved its 2025 global gre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ions goal two years ahead of schedule, reducing Scope 1 and Scope 2 emissions by over 35% (2014 baseline).
  • Implemented 15 energy saving projects across its manufacturing facilities in 2023, resulting in more than 3,000 MWh of energy savings per year.
  • Has continued its implementation of internal carbon pricing across its manufacturing facilities.
  • Has reduced power consumption at least 10% year over year in its flagship Snapdragon Mobile Platform.
  • As of 2023, 88% of primary semiconductor manufacturing suppliers have received code of conduct audits, maintaining progress toward its goal of 100% by 2025.
  • Wireless Reach achieved its 2025 goal in 2023 to bring technology to 27 million people in underserved communities (2006 baseline).
  • As of 2023, the company has engaged over 4.7 million students and teachers across the globe through strategic STEM initiatives, more than triple its 2025 goal of 1.5 million.
  • Received numerous recognitions, including Forbes’ "World’s Most Admired Companies" and Newsweek’s "America’s Greenest Companies."

2021

QUALCOMM — Committed to reaching net zero by 2040 and joined ​​the Business Ambition for 1.5°C campaign. It also set interim targets of reducing absolute Scope 1 and 2 emissions by 50%, and reducing absolute Scope 3 emissions by 25%, by 2030 (2020 baseline). (Nov 2021)
MORE »


QUALCOMM — Announced 2025 goals to reduce Scope 1 and 2 GHG emissions by 30% and to increase representation of women and underrepresented minorities in leadership roles by 15%. (February 2021)
